Your measurements seem a bit odd: the source measurement has a bit worse (very tiny bit, but still) noise floor than the DUT. Also, the DUT has slightly less distortion than the source.
I have no need myself for an headphone amplifier or analog preamp but I'm curious to see what you are up to
Your measurements seem a bit odd: the source measurement has a bit worse (very tiny bit, but still) noise floor than the DUT. Also, the DUT has slightly less distortion than the source.
That's because source snap has a 137dB range while pre-out snap has 140dB. My mistake.
Noise floor is at same distance from 0dB in both cases, but the smaller range setting makes source out to have a higher noise.
Lower apparent harmonic level in pre out can be due to phase difference between the same harmonics from source and pre-out Scheduled for check how much off phase the individual pre harmonics are relative to source harmonics.
